Positions have arisen, within the Customer Care Directorate, to prioritise, handle and action calls within our Adult Social Care First Response Service.
You will receive calls from adults wishing to access Social Care services across Rhondda Cynon Taf, in line with processes and protocols will escalate as and when necessary. You will also pro-actively contact service users, in line with a preventative approach to their health and well-being.
You will work as part of a team rota that covers the service between the hours of 8.30am and 18.30pm, Monday to Friday.
Excellent communication skills, particularly telephone techniques, are required. Effective use of ICT systems is also essential. Experience of working in a team and in a Contact Centre environment is also a requirement.
You will be an individual with a positive, can-do attitude and a desire to deliver outstanding customer service.
